Q: Should the TCS be on or off on a 2004 Honda Accord V6?

What does the TCS button on a 2004 Honda accord do?

TCS is an acronym with the meaning "Traction Control System." It prevents wheel spin in low-traction situations. Pressing the button will cause a light on the dash to illuminate. When the light is on, is means the system is disabled. It's a good idea to leave it on, as it can the wear on your differential.
